大孔树脂分离纯化“黑金刚”紫马铃薯花青苷工艺研究

摘    要:以紫色马铃薯"黑金刚"花青苷为原料,采用D101、HDP100A、HDP450A、NK-9、AB-8五种大孔吸附树脂对花青苷的吸附与解析特性进行了比较研究,并在此基础上,采用最佳大孔树脂对花青苷纯化过程中的静态、动态吸附和解析附条件进行了优化研究。结果表明AB-8大孔树脂具有较好的吸附和解析能力,是纯化紫色马铃薯花青苷的最佳树脂,较优纯化条件为:上样液花青苷浓度为0.028mg.g-1,上样液pH=2,洗脱液乙醇浓度为50%,洗脱液pH=1,吸附流速为1mL.min-1,洗脱流速为1mL.min-1。经大孔树脂纯化后,色价值比纯化前提高了7.55倍。

Isolation and Purification of Anthocyanins from "Heijingang" Purple Potato with Macroporous Resins

Abstract:With purple potato "heijinggang" cyanine glycosides as raw material, D101, HDP100A, HDP450A, NK-9 and AB-8 five kinds of macroporous resin were adopted to the comparative study of desorption and adsorption characteristics. The best macroporous resin was adopted to optimize the conditions of dynamic adsorption and the purification procedures of anthocyanin. The results showed that AB-8 macroporous resins exhibited the best performance due to its better adsorption and desorption capability. The optimal purification conditions were: sample concentration of 0. 028 mg· mL -1, ethanol concentration of 50%, sample pH= 2, ethanol pH= 1, sample flow rate of 1 mL· min-1 and ethanol flow rate of 1 mL · min-1. Under this condition, the color value was increased 7.55 times than before.
